Position OverviewGeneral Manager – Thunder Jet BoatsUnder the direction of the ABG President, the General Manager is responsible for managing and coordinating all aspects of Thunder Jet business including manufacturing, engineering, product development, marketing, human resources, finance, customer service and purchasing. The role also ensures safe, effective and efficient operation of the facility. The General Manager must attain or exceed all operational and financial goals for the facility. Responsibilities include quality, cost, delivery, safety, morale and continuous improvement.Essential FunctionsManage and lead a cross‑functional group representing manufacturing, product development, engineering, purchasing, human resources, finance, customer service and marketing.Tactical management of the business planning cycle inclusive of market pricing: forecasting, backlog management, incentive plans, customer visits, quoting and execution of orders sufficient to drive the sales and production plans.Work with sales team and customers to ensure satisfaction with product and service.Generate and execute a business unit strategic and tactical plans.Coordinate and integrate new product development process with defined charters and phase‑gate process.Assist team to resolve issues, remove barriers and create a positive working culture.Effectively manage fiscal sales and marketing budgets.Develop operational and team goals aligned with business and financial plans and lead team to execute them.Create, monitor and maintain production schedules to meet all customer delivery requirements, coordinating schedules across functions and manufacturing areas.Lead & execute plant performance metrics (e.g., productivity), institute processes and metrics to measure and monitor performance and communicate to all levels.Direct materials management activities to ensure optimal parts presentation and inventory levels.Develop operational and facility plans for the short and long term, including capital, human resources and process strategies.Review overall labor and material requirements to minimize costs without jeopardizing necessary functions and customer delivery (and quality) requirements.Create a culture of making problems visible and provide coaching to address problems quickly.Establish and manage budgets and targets for the facility.Champion employee safety, ensuring facility compliance with Brunswick policies, procedures and regulatory agencies.Create and maintain a continuous improvement culture.Achieve or exceed financial goals for the facility.Lead and participate in cost‑reduction activities supporting annual planning targets.Required QualificationsDemonstrated cross‑functional management capability; matrix management experience required.Ability to produce results with dotted‑line reporting relationships.Ability to understand and manage the role and interrelationship of each organizational function.Ability to play a variety of leadership roles; supporting, delegating, coaching and driving as necessary and appropriate.Knowledge and/or experience in operations management.Ability to effectively lead new product development and timely execution.Ability to travel 15%–25% supporting dealers, boat shows and all organizational activities.Education & ExperienceBachelor’s degree in Manufacturing, Engineering, Operations, Management or related discipline required; MBA preferred.8–10 years of experience in a manufacturing environment with progressive responsibility leading a team, preferably as leader of entire operations.Working knowledge of manufacturing processes, welding.Proven depth of manufacturing experience; VA/VE (Value Analysis/Value Engineering) experience desired.Experience with OSHA and EPA regulations.Knowledge of USCG, ABYC and NMMA standards beneficial.Excellent interpersonal, written and verbal communication skills required.Working knowledge of project management and related software (e.g., Microsoft Project).Outstanding analytical and statistical technical skills required to gather and summarize data to find solutions in product, messaging and services.Technical or professional knowledge of business planning, facility planning and headcount planning required.Ability to build relationships and credibility among key matrixed stakeholders.The anticipated pay range is $129,500.00 – $170,000.00 annually, with potential for an annual discretionary bonus. Additional benefits include medical, dental, vision, paid vacation, 401(k) (up to 4% match), Health Savings Account with company contribution, well‑being program, product purchase discounts and more. #J-18808-Ljbffr
